Ingredients
2egg yolks, whisked
1/4cupmilk
1Tbspbutter (1/2 Tbsp butter will work too)
1/2cupall purpose flour
1/2tspraw honey
1/8tspsalt
1/4tspmolasses (optional)
1/2tspraw honey
Instructions
Butter your baking pan.
Cook or heat milk with butter to melt, just below boil.
Add flour, honey, salt, and whisked egg yolks to a bowl. Combine with a spoon. (An easy way is to whisk the eggs first in the bowl, switch to a spoon, and then add the flour and other ingredients.)
Pour heated milk-butter over the flour-egg bowl while stirring with a silverware spoon (recommended) constantly to prevent eggs from scrambling. You can pour a little of the hot milk at a time in the beginning, mix/stir a liitle, if you can't stir with one hand and pour constantly with the other hand.
Refrigerate batter for a few hours or overnight, for better bake rise results. You can also bake after you make the batter if you want. The taste will stay about the same.
Pour batter into baking pan at 450°F for 15 minutes in a regular oven. Then turn the oven down to 350°F for at least 45 minutes or until color desired. Caneles are dark color.
